What is Skycap Investment Holdings EV-to-EBIT?

Skycap Investment Holdings LIMFF EV-to-EBIT is 0.37 as of Jul. 26, 2026. The stock has 3 warning signs investors should review. Among 497 Asset Management companies, Skycap Investment Holdings ranks better than 89.74% on this metric.

EV-to-EBIT is calculated as Enterprise Value divided by its EBIT. As of today, Skycap Investment Holdings's Enterprise Value is $-1.15 Mil. Skycap Investment Holdings's E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2025 was $-3.10 Mil. Therefore, Skycap Investment Holdings's EV-to-EBIT for today is 0.37.

Skycap Investment Holdings  (OTCPK:LIMFF) EV-to-EBIT Explanation

This is a more accurate valuation of companies' operation because it considers the debt and cash on its balance sheet, and non-operating items such as interest payment, tax, and one-time items are not included in the Operating Income.

Joel Greenblatt calls the inversion of this ratio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) %.

Skycap Investment Holdings's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as:

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% (Q: Dec. 2025 ) =EBIT / Enterprise Value (Q: Dec. 2025 )
=-3.1/-3.3821191
=91.66 %
